马国华 %A 许秋生 %A 羡蕴兰 %J 热带亚热带植物学报 %D 1999 %I %X Primary somatic embryogenesis could be directly induced from immature leaves ofcassava (Manihot esculenta Crantz) on the MS solidified medium supplemented with higherconcentration of 2,4-D (1 - 16 mg L-1) or NAA (40 mg L-1), but IBA and IAA (40 mg L-1)could not induce it. When the somatic embryo fragments were used as explants, the needof auxin activity and concentration for the induction of secondary somatic embryogenesisdecreased. The decrease of the concentration or activity of the auxins in the induction mediacould enhance somatic embryogenesis and root formation, and result in the increase ofplant regeneration frequency. It was observed that somatic embryos could not developshoot meristem on the induction medium containing 4 mg L-1 2,4-D. The experimentsshowed that the auxins stimulated the induction of cassava somatic embryogenesis butinhibited the development of somatic embryos and decrease plant regeneration in cassava. %K Manihot esculenta %K Auxins %K Somatic embryogenesis %K Plant regeneration
